This course expands the knowledge, skills, and abilities developed through Levels 1 and 2 and provides the opportunity for students to apply these skills in the field. The students move from generalized situations to those that more closely mimic realistic challenges and responsibilities of living in the hearing world. This course emphasizes real-life experiences both in and out of the classroom, incorporating higher-level communication responsibility, larger groups, and noisy environments. Through these listening experiences, students evaluate their relationship with technology and, ultimately, assess their self-efficacy related to living successfully with hearing loss.

Additional Information
- Speechreading: individualized computer practice and group in-class practice
- Assertiveness
- Emotional impact of hearing loss
- Work, family, and social implications
- Giving effective presentations
- Giving and receiving feedback
- Advocacy: resources and networking
- Disability rights in Canada
- Technology: hearing aids, hearing assistive technology (HATs), apps
- Real-life scenarios in the classroom: e.g., listening in noise, participating in a larger group, participating in cooperative challenges
- Real-life experiences in the field: e.g., communicating in unfamiliar or challenging environments, communicating with unfamiliar people
- Self-efficacy
